  • Treatment

    Spinal Fusion Surgery

    Spinal fusion surgery stabilizes and corrects the curvature of the spine; and for scoliosis and kyphosis, prevents further curvature of the spine. Stabilizing the spine can improve movement, reduce pain and restore lung function.

  • Treatment

    Tenotomy

    Tenotomy is the cutting of a tendon. This and related procedures are also called tendon release, tendon lengthening, and heel-cord release, and is a part of the treatment process for Clubfoot at Shriners Children's.
